Output 7031194cc036fafc3d5ad8c419013383564bf5d2c6984a488f1ce55b958e6a3d:27

value
30023
script pubkey
OP_0 OP_PUSHBYTES_20 4143f1051ace10edbe2de48609e665c989d7215a
address
bc1qg9plzpg6ecgwm03dujrqnen9exyawg26h2z6mk
transaction
7031194cc036fafc3d5ad8c419013383564bf5d2c6984a488f1ce55b958e6a3d
spent
true